The way people eat news has changed dramatically during the last two decades. Traditional newspapers and television broadcasts once dominated the media landscape, but the fast growth of the internet has transformed how information is produced, distributed, and consumed. Digital news platforms now play a central position in delivering news to world audiences, providing immediate access to tales, multimedia content, and real-time updates. This shift has reshaped the relationship between news organizations and readers, creating each opportunities and challenges.
Digital news platforms embrace online newspapers, independent news websites, mobile news apps, and social media channels that distribute journalistic content. Unlike traditional media, these platforms operate around the clock, allowing journalists to publish updates the moment events occur. Readers no longer need to wait for the morning newspaper or scheduled broadcasts to find out about vital developments. Instead, they will receive breaking news alerts directly on their smartphones.
Some of the significant advantages of digital news platforms is accessibility. Anyone with an internet connection can access an enormous range of news sources from across the world. Readers can compare completely different views, explore specialised topics, and stay informed about global occasions without geographic limitations. This expanded access to information empowers readers to develop a broader understanding of present issues.
One other essential function of digital news is personalization. Many platforms use algorithms and person preferences to deliver tailored news feeds. Readers can choose topics that interest them most, resembling politics, technology, business, health, or entertainment. Personalized recommendations help customers navigate the overwhelming amount of content material available on-line and concentrate on tales that match their interests.
The rise of digital news platforms has additionally changed how readers interact with news content. Online articles typically embrace multimedia elements such as videos, infographics, interactive charts, and live updates. These features make stories more engaging and simpler to understand. Readers also can participate in discussions through comment sections, social media shares, and community boards, making a more interactive news environment.
Speed is one other defining attribute of digital journalism. News organizations can report on events in real time, providing updates as tales unfold. Live blogs, push notifications, and social media updates enable readers to follow major developments minute by minute. This immediacy has increased the demand for fast reporting and constant updates.
Nevertheless, the expansion of digital news platforms has additionally launched new challenges. The speed of on-line publishing sometimes leads to the spread of misinformation or incomplete reporting. Readers should develop sturdy media literacy skills to guage the credibility of sources and distinguish between reliable journalism and misleading content. Truth-checking and critical thinking have turn into essential habits within the digital news era.
Another challenge entails the economic sustainability of digital journalism. Many traditional newspapers have struggled to take care of revenue as print circulation declines. In response, news organizations have adopted subscription models, paywalls, and membership programs to assist their digital operations. Readers are increasingly asked to pay for high-quality journalism that provides accurate reporting and in-depth analysis.
Despite these challenges, digital news platforms proceed to evolve and expand. Advances in artificial intelligence, data journalism, and mobile technology are shaping the future of online media. Newsrooms are experimenting with new storytelling formats, podcasts, newsletters, and interactive features that enhance the reader experience.
For readers, the rise of digital news platforms represents both larger opportunity and greater responsibility. Access to information has never been simpler, but navigating the digital media environment requires awareness and discernment. Readers should select trustworthy sources, verify information, and remain open to diverse perspectives.
Digital news platforms have fundamentally transformed how society consumes information. As technology continues to advance, these platforms will remain central to the global flow of news, shaping how readers stay informed, interact with current occasions, and understand the world round them.
